The Old Model Is Broken

The numbers don't lie. The global live events industry is valued at over $82 billion and growing toward $146 billion by 2030. Yet independent event producers, the creators who build the most compelling, authentic experiences, fail at disproportionately high rates.

Why? Because the traditional ticketing model offers no financial floor. Every event starts at zero. Revenue is unpredictable, upfront costs are massive, and one bad weekend can wipe out months of profit. Even producers with loyal audiences, proven track records, and thousands of followers aren't immune.

Eventbrite, POSH, DICE, and their competitors built platforms around the transaction, not the relationship. They monetize the ticket sale, not the community behind it. That's a fundamental mismatch with how the best event businesses actually work.

The most successful event producers don't just sell tickets. They build tribes. Their attendees aren't customers, they're members. And it's time the technology caught up.

The Rise of the Membership Economy in Live Events

Across nearly every other creative industry, the subscription model has already won.

Musicians earn recurring income through Patreon and fan memberships. Fitness studios replaced drop-in passes with monthly dues. Private clubs have always understood that loyalty, not volume, is the key to longevity.

Live events are the last major entertainment category still stuck in the pay-per-transaction era and that's exactly where the opportunity lies.

When event attendance becomes a membership, everything changes:

For producers, revenue becomes predictable. You know, before a single event is announced, that your members are committed for the month, the quarter, or the year. That stability funds better talent, better venues, and bolder creative choices.

For attendees, membership transforms the relationship from consumer to community member. You're not buying a ticket to a party. You're part of something. You get access, identity, and belonging, not just an event.

For communities, membership creates continuity. The connection between events deepens. People show up not just to be entertained but to see their people.
